USA Today's 10 Best is looking for the Best City Food Festival in America and events in Minnesota and Iowa have made the list of 20 finalists.

Get our free mobile app

In the North Star State, the Uptown Food Truck Festival made the cut.

This event has attracted more than 60 food trucks previously and has three stops planned for 2023:

  • June 24 - Hopkins
  • July 22 - St. Paul
  • August 19 - Anoka

In the Hawkeye State, the World Food & Music Festival is up for consideration.

This event, which began in 2005, is held each summer at Western Gateway Park in Downtown Des Moines.

The 2023 festival runs from August 25 to August 27.
